Monopoly GO Apologizes With Free Tokens for Marvel Album Glitch

Monopoly GO players are receiving free compensation tokens to address recent technical issues that disrupted their gaming experience during the Marvel GO album season. Specifically, the issues affected Spider Gwen and Nick Fury tokens, leaving many players unable to claim these rewards from September 26 to December 5.

To make amends, Monopoly GO developers are delivering missing Marvel tokens directly to player inboxes. Players who already own all Marvel tokens will instead receive dice rolls as a one-time compensation.

The Marvel GO album featured superhero-themed sticker sets, offering rewards like cash, dice rolls, emojis, and shields. Players could earn tokens through events like the Asgardian Treasure Hunt, Quick Wins tasks, and community chests. However, technical glitches prevented some from receiving their hard-earned rewards.

The compensation coincides with the launch of the Jingle Joy album, which runs until January 16. This new festive album introduces fresh sticker sets, tokens, and rewards, including 10,000 rolls, a Santa token, and cash for completing the collection. Players can also participate in the Team Adventures event for additional rewards.

Players affected by the glitch are encouraged to log in promptly to claim their tokens or dice rolls and dive into the new album’s holiday festivities.
